Quick Answer: How To Check Git Version On Mac

Check your version of Git You can check your current version of Git by running the git –version command in a terminal (Linux, macOS) or command prompt (Windows). If you don’t see a supported version of Git, you’ll need to either upgrade Git or perform a fresh install, as described below.

How do I find where git is installed on my Mac?

simply type in which git in your terminal window and it will show you exactly where it was installed. Coda 2, prefers this path than the soft link at /usr/bin. Mostly in /usr/local/git (there are also /etc/paths. d/git and /etc/manpaths.

How do I update git on Mac?

The easiest way to update Git on Mac is to use the official installer. Download the installation file from the Git website. Run the installation and follow the install wizard to update Git to the latest version. Note: Using the install wizard to update Git overwrites the current installation.

Are Git and GitHub the same?

what’s the difference? Simply put, Git is a version control system that lets you manage and keep track of your source code history. GitHub is a cloud-based hosting service that lets you manage Git repositories.

Can you use Git without GitHub?

Github and others Git is a piece of open source software. You can use Git without ever using an online host like Github; you would still get the benefits of saved backups and a log of your changes. However, using Github (or the others) allows you store this on a server so that you can access anywhere or share.

Should I install Git or GitHub?

Git is an open-source, version control tool created in 2005 by developers working on the Linux operating system; GitHub is a company founded in 2008 that makes tools which integrate with git. You do not need GitHub to use git, but you cannot use GitHub without using git.

What is git MV?

git mv moves the file, updating the index to record the replaced file path, as well as updating any affected git submodules. Unlike a manual move, it also detects case-only renames that would not otherwise be detected as a change by git.
